The Cast of Disney+’s “Just Beyond” Talk Behind-The -Scenes Secrets, the Show’s Spooky Creation and More! (Exclusive)

Disney + has gifted fans a new spooky series that you will definitely want to add to your Halloween watch list! Just Beyond invites viewers to step “just beyond” the world we know with episodes including monsters, witches, aliens, ghosts and more.

Inspired by the works of legendary author R.L. Stine, those who dare to watch are in for a treat!

According to a press release, “Stine, prolific author of young-adult horror fiction, including the ‘Goosebumps’ and ‘Fear Street’ series, has been scaring readers worldwide for over 35 years. The show’s creators referenced his popular page-turners while developing their new series of hair-raising stories.”

Fans of the popular book series can now enjoy frightful entertainment on-screen. Each episode of Just Beyond holds a different cast of characters, a brand new storyline and a fair share of thrilling scares.

Disney+

Celeb Secrets sat down (virtually) with some of the masterminds behind the show, as well as some of Just Beyond’s incredible cast. Writer and showrunner Seth Grahame-Smith and co-executive producer R.L. Stine shared with us how they came to turn a beloved book series into a top-notch TV series.

“Well for me, it was writing books for thirty years,” Stine said.

“For me it was very simple,” Grahame-Smith said. “Somebody brought me this brand new graphic novel series by R.L. Stine called ‘Just Beyond’ and said ‘Hey, this would make a great tv show. What do you think?’ and I said ‘I agree’ and we got to work on it and here we are a year or so later.”

Grahame-Smith explained that when working on this project, they sought to channel some of TV’s most classic scary shows.

“We were thinking about shows like the Twilight Zone or like Amazing Stories, these great shows that just kind of told these, once a week, they would tell a story and a story with a beginning, a middle and an end and the next week it would be a whole new story. And we were really excited about doing something like that and so, you know, doing Just Beyond gave us the opportunity to try it.”

While the show’s blueprint included a plan to package up a different plotline in each episode, Stine shared that one aspect always remains the same, “to scare.”

We always have the same goal and that’s just to scare kids mainly,” Stine said. “… and just to have fun!”

In Episode 2: Parents Are From Mars, Kids Are From Venus, best friends Jack and Gabriel discover their parents are aliens.

Gabriel Bateman, who plays Mark, said that he probably would go “into a coma” if he was in Jack’s shoes.

“Probably like go into a coma or faint or something,” Bateman said. “I don’t know, I definitely wouldn’t handle it as well as Jack did. I think first I would accept that my parents weren’t who they said they were and then secondly, I’d have to accept that aliens actually exist…”

Tapping into extraterrestrial terrors that may cease to exist, the show also tackles real world problems that exist for many.

Photo Credit : Disney/Fernando Decillis

In Episode 6: We’ve Got Spirits, Yes We Do, Ella has to face not only some friendly ghosts but an ex-best friend. Actress Lexi Underwood, who plays Ella, said that channeling this character included pulling from real-life experiences.

“I have not had any interactions with ghosts, very very grateful about that, but friendships and dealing with having to face your fears is something I definitely know all too well,” Underwood said.

“Change is a part of life,” Underwood explained. “It’s apart of the human experience and friendship breakups I think are something that everybody goes through it you know like I said it’s apart of the human experience so I can definitely relate, I can definitely relate to Ella and Ella feeling scared and unsure of how she would move on and how she should proceed. But also, I feel like I’ve learned something from Ella in the way that she did handle her situation and the way that she at the end of the day she faced fears..”
